Web4 okt. 2024 · There are two main ways to insulate your walls internally. The first method is to fit rigid insulation boards onto the inside surface of the walls. These insulation boards come with the insulation material a part of them. The second method is to construct a stud wall and then manually fill it with insulation material. Web4 dec. 2012 · The insulation is blown into the empty wall cavity (we’re assuming an uninsulated wall here). You would drill a hole in the top and bottom of each wall cavity, filling it as best you can without seeing inside. (I’ll go into a bit more on the logistic challenges in the next article.

WebWall insulation. Up to 25 per cent of heat from an average uninsulated home is lost through the walls. Once you have insulated your ceilings and under your floor, think about wall insulation. You should especially consider adding wall insulation when you are removing cladding or linings for any reason – it is the easiest and most cost ...
